I've been contemplating replacing the downpipes on my S4 for some cat less ones what options have I got? I'm aware there a pig to fit but what seriously is the best way of changing them preferably without taking the engine out? I have also seen something about having flexis welded in is this necessary?

Matt
 
The stock system has flexis, which stops the exhaust moving around under the car from stressing out the turbo/manifolds etc.

Many aftermarket DP's for the S4 also have flexis.

However the cheap XS power ones from ebay do not, and thus when fitting those its recommended that you fit flexis.

The XS ones are reasonable value but arent always the easiest to fit due to quality control issues.

In general doing DP's on the S4 is an awkward job, requiring lots of patience and wrestling with 6000 wobbly sockets and extensions. Doesnt need the engine out though.
